What SEC codes are Consumer Only?
PPD, POS, TEL and WEB
What type of entries can a Prearranged Payment and Deposit Entry (PPD) have?
Single Entry, Recurring Entry, or Subsequent Entry. Can be either debit or credit entries
Amount of Addenda Records supported for PPD
1 Optional Addenda Record
Authorization/agreement requirements for Prearranged Payment and Deposit Entry (PPD)
Debit Entry authorization must be in writing and signed or similarly authenticated and Receiver must receive copy of authorization
What type of entries can a Point of Sale Entry (POS) have?
Single Entry or Subsequent Entry. Debit or credit (recredit for POS debit)
Amount of Addenda Records supported for POS
1Mandatory Addenda Record
Authorization requirements for POS
Initiated at electronic terminal (defined by Reg E) and PIN security (ANSI ASC X9.8 standards)
What type of entries can a Telephone-Initiated Entry (TEL) have?
Single Entry, Recurring Entry, or Subsequent Entry and only debit
Amount of Addenda Records supported for TEL.
No Addenda Record

Non-Consumer Only SEC Products
CCD, CTX and CIE
What type of entries can a CCD have?
Single Entry Only and Corporate Credit, debit, or Zero-Dollar Entry
Amount of Addenda Records supported for CCD
1 Optional Addenda Record
What type of entries can a CTX have?
Single Entry only, Corporate Trade Exchange Entry and Credit, debit, or Zero-Dollar Entry
Amount of Addenda Records supported for CTX
Supports optional 9,999 Addenda Records
What type of entries can a CIE have?
Single Entry and credit only
Authorization for CIE entries
No written authorization requirement for CIE
